What are few comma rules?

1. When independent clauses are united by one of the following seven coordinating conjunctions: and, but, for, or, nor, so, yet, use commas to separate them.

2. Add commas at the end of the following opening elements: a) sentences, b) phrases, or c) words.

3. Set off clauses, phrases, and words that aren't necessary to the sentence's content with a pair of commas in the centre of your sentences.

4.When separating important sentence components, such as sentences starting with that, avoid using commas (relative clauses).

5.When writing three or more words, phrases, or clauses in a row, use commas to separate them.

6. Separate two or more coordinate adjectives that refer to the same noun using commas.

What is a simile?

A simile is a device of speech that compares two things explicitly. Similes vary from other metaphors in that they highlight the similarities between two items by employing comparison terms like "like," "as," "so," or "than," whereas other metaphors generate an implicit comparison.

In the preceding example, the narrator's father is compared to "an ancient oak hit by lightning." using the word "like".

Figurative language is a technique of expressing oneself that does not rely on the literal or practical meaning of a term. Figurative language, which is prevalent in comparisons and exaggerations, is typically employed to add artistic flair to written or spoken language or to convey a complex concept.

What differentiates a zine from a magazine?

A zine is typically a non-commercial, unprofessional periodical that resembles a magazine but differs in several ways. The fundamental distinction between a zine and a magazine is that zines exist more for the purpose of introducing new, frequently unheard voices into the conversation than for financial gain.
